What:An open session meeting of the Western New York Regional Economic Development Council, which will include CFA status reports; a "Buffalo Billion" update; and presentations on the New York State Energy Research & Development Authority Cleaner Greener Communities Sustainability Plan for Western New York, Path Through History's heritage tourism marketing plan and New York State "Work for Success" Employment Initiative.
During the meeting, organizers will unveil a new marketing effort designed to attract additional development to Western New York.
Who:All individuals, businesses, organizations, labor representatives and university representatives from the Western New York Region are welcome to attend the public meeting and press conference.
Where:UB Clinical and Translational Research Center (CTRC), 875 Ellicott St., 5th floor, Buffalo
Parking is available in the garage across the street from the CTRC. If you park in the garage, please bring your parking stub with you to the meeting to be validated. On-street parking is limited due to construction activity, but is available on North Street.
When: Thursday, May 2
The Western New York Regional Economic Development Council is co-chaired by University at Buffalo President Satish Tripathi and Larkin Development Group Managing Partner Howard Zemsky. The region is composed of Allegany, Cattaraugus, Chautauqua, Erie and Niagara counties.
